Lockerbie Station provides a balanced blend of ess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. You will find a ticket office with friendly staff ready to assist from 06:50 to 20: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and 10:50 to 18:00 on Sundays. Collecting tickets purchased online is easy at the ticket office, though it's worth noting there are no ticket machines or smartcard facilities here.
With step-free access throughout the station, Lockerbie caters excellently to passengers with reduced mobility. The station is equipped with acc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and customer help points to provide assistance if needed. While there's no car park CCTV, ample free parking is available, including three accessible spaces.
While catering mostly to short-term needs, the absence of refreshment facilities or retail outlets on-site suggests planning ahead for snacks or shopping is wise. However, for staying informed, departure screens and timely announcements are available, ensuring passengers have the latest travel updates.

Falmer station takes care of its travelers with a variety of facilities. There's a staffed ticket office open from 06:25 to 19:50 during weekdays and Saturdays, although it closes earlier on Sundays at 16:45. If you're in a hurry, ticket machines are readily available and accessible to all passengers, including those eligible for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
For those requiring assistance, staff are available throughout the week with comprehensive support services, including a help point on the platforms. It's advised to book assistance two hours in advance but "turn up and go" assistance is facilitated when possible. Train carriages themselves often have staff able to lend a hand, ensuring a hassle-free journey.
Safety at the station is prioritized with CCTV in place, and an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. While there are toilets on Platform 2, the station lacks accessible toilets and baby changing facilities. Comfortable unheated waiting shelters provide respite between journeys, and there's seating for passengers choosing to rest their feet.
